Summary
CVE-2024-34145 is a high-severity Authentication Bypass by Spoofing (CWE-290) vulnerability in Jenkins Script Security. Its CVSS base score is 8.8 (High).
Operationally, ranked at the 24.0th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og.

Vulnerability details
A sandbox bypass vulnerability involving sandbox-defined classes that shadow specific non-sandbox-defined classes in Jenkins Script Security Plugin 1335.vf07d9ce377a_e and earlier allows attackers with permission to define and run sandboxed scripts, including Pipelines, to bypass the sandbox protection and execute arbitrary…
more
code in the context of the Jenkins controller JVM.
